In the `__init__` method you need to create your model, and pass it to the `super().__init__` call. There the model is wrapped into a `GroupedModel` which splits the model parameters into weight_decay and non-weight_decay groups. If you want to specify your own parameter groups (e.g. for different learning rates) you need to wrap your model in a `GroupedModel` yourself, before passing it to the `super().__init__` call.
